Definition
To officially transfer ownership or legal rights to someone else by signing a document.

Listen in Context
He decided to sign over the car to his brother.
She will sign over her share of the property to her son.
The company had to sign over some assets to pay its debts.
After a long discussion, Margaret decided to sign over the family land to her sister.
